Abstract
RF MEMS activities until now has been driven by universities. For production of these enabling components a new industry is needed. RF MEMS processing is very different and even incompatible with traditional IC processing for at least two reasons: (1) the metals used are unfamiliar and often forbidden in semiconductor processing, (2) making free standing structures needs a specialist knowledge of the properties and the processing of these metals. Even for experienced MEMS institutes/companies making these products is a challenge, and as a result, they can only fulfill the first demands of the customers: i.e. testing of the possibilities of this new technology and proving its feasibility. These first players are generalists, having a broad knowledge of MEMS processes and applications. However, upcoming demand from the market asks different capabilities. Most customers nowadays are not looking for a few `breadboard' samples based on the latest available processes. They need non-technical capabilities like: reproducibility, reliability, timely delivery, etc. Much work has to be done to fit the design demands into the foundries and bring the production processes to a level comparable to mature industries such as semiconductor or magnetic head industries.
